Question 681449: write an equation of the line that is perpendicular to the given line and passes through the given point. y=x-7(0,-5)

y=x-7 and (0,-5)
y=x-7
compare with the equation y = mx+b
m=1
so the slope is 1
the slope of line perpendicular to this line will be -1 (negative reciprocal)
using the equation
y-y1=m(x-x1) where m is the slope and (x1,y1) are the co ordibnates of the point on the line.
y-(-5)=-1(x-0)
y+5=-x
y=-x-5 is the equation
